The Knowing-Saying Gap: When Probes See Errors that Confidence Misses

arXiv:2608.07528v1 Announce Type: new Abstract: Linear probes detect corrupted context in language models with near-perfect accuracy, yet this does not translate into reliable failure prediction. The result is a dissociation with direct implications for deployment monitoring.
